Colleen Nelson is a hero contact in the The Cresent neighborhood of Brickstown. Colleen Nelson is a Mutation origin contact. Her level range is 35-39.

Information

Assistant District Attorney

Up until very recently, Colleen Nelson was an extremely high paid attorney. She worked for Pinckney & Sons, a notorious law firm that occasionally defends the Council against charges of vandalism and sabotage. Colleen was right in the middle of one such case when she quit, accepting a job at the district attorney's office along with a severe salary cut. No one can get her to talk about the reasons behind her resignation, but in the months since, she's been whole-heartedly dedicated to taking on the Council. No single person has done more to damage the mysterious group, with the possible exception of Manticore, one of Colleen's closest associates.

Prevent reanimations of fallen leaders

Briefing

It seems the Council has decided to try their hand at magic. They've managed to recover the bodies of several deceased Council leaders, and they're going to try to reanimate them! That's a dangerous proposition, to say nothing of disgusting. I need you to prevent the Council from reaniming their fallen leaders. You'll have to hurry. The ceremony could take as little as 90 minutes.

Mission acceptance

I'm counting on you to stop this, Hero. The Council is bad enough as it is!

Mission Objective(s)

  • Defeat all villains in base (90 minutes to do it)
  • Objective 2

Debriefing

Job well done, Hero. I guess it's true that the Council will go to any lenghts to gain any measure of power. Their roots date all the way back to the 1940s, and, let me tell you, they've spawned some frightening characters during that time.
